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How much does a Goethe-Zertifikat expense?
Exam fees differ significantly depending upon the test center place, the level of the exam, and whether the prospect is taking the complete examination or private modules. Normally, prices range from EUR150 to over EUR350. It is best to examine the specific rates directly with the regional Goethe-Institut or certified partner exam center.
2. Can I retake just one part of the test if I fail?
Yes, for most examinations at levels B1 through C2, the test is modular. If a candidate passes three modules but fails the fourth (e.g., Writing), they only require to retake the Writing module within a defined timeframe, rather than the whole test.
3. Are the examinations computer-based or paper-based?
The Goethe-Institut offers both formats, depending upon the test center. While traditional paper-and-pen tests are still extensively offered, digital exams (Goethe-Zertifikat Digital) are ending up being increasingly typical at picked test areas, enabling candidates to type their answers and listen by means of earphones.
4. The length of time does it take to get the results?
Typically, outcomes and certificates are readily available within two to 4 weeks after the evaluation date. Candidates can examine their status online or get the physical certificate directly from the test center.
5. Is the Goethe-Zertifikat accepted for German citizenship?
Yes. For German naturalization functions, the Goethe-Zertifikat B1 (or greater) is formally acknowledged as proof of the needed language proficiency.
